|03-20-2013, 08:54 PM||#1|
Join Date: May 2010
Device: Sony PRS-T1
Custom columns to call up metadata from epub's opf?
I have a collection of epubs that include both author (<dc:creator opf:role="aut">) and artist (<dc:creator opf:role="art">) information in the opf. The author information displays just fine, but I think I need to create a column to display the artists. I'd rather not have to add this information from scratch. Is there any way to create a column that will read this information if it exists in the epub...?
|03-21-2013, 04:33 AM||#2|
CC Android Developer
Join Date: Jan 2010
Device: Many android devices
No. Custom columns can read only the info in calibre's database for the book.
One way to get started would be to use the command line. Write a script/program that scans your library for epubs, extracts the OPF from the epub, extracts the artist information from that opf, then writes that information to a custom column using calibredb set_custom. The library scan could use a search to look for books that have not been processed, perhaps a tag or perhaps a boolean custom column.
|Thread Tools||Search this Thread|
|Thread||Thread Starter||Forum||Replies||Last Post|
|Custom columns and metadata sources||kiwidude||Development||30||06-05-2014 01:36 AM|
|Order of Custom Columns in Metadata Editor||BetterRed||Calibre||2||08-29-2012 12:47 AM|
|Metadata and custom columns||dbolack||Development||9||03-05-2012 09:07 AM|
|Custom columns and epub metadata||xmodder||Library Management||7||11-22-2011 09:31 PM|
|importing metadata into custom columns||taleia||Library Management||3||07-07-2011 08:31 AM|